 1. The brother of George Zimmerman says he'll always be looking over his shoulder - despite his acquittal in the death of Trayvon Martin. There have been rallies against the verdict acroos the country. 

 
 
 
2. Actress Lea Michele is said to be devastated1 by the death of her "Glee" co-star and real-life boyfriend, Cory Monteith. The 31-year-old actor was found dead in a Vancouver hotel room yesterday. Monteith had a history of addiction2
 
 
 
3. Typhoon Soulik has been downgraded to a storm. That storm forced the evacuation of 300,000 people in China's Fujian Province. It cut power to more than half a million around Taipei. 
 
 
 
4. And France celebrated3 Bastille Day. This time welcoming 13 African countries that helped lead the war against al-Qaida-linked extremists in Mali.
